The Uragan bench
A benchtop rig for propulsion sets drawing up to 110 A. Seven measurement channels, a Bluetooth link, in-house software and individual factory calibration of every unit.
Measured parameters
All channels run simultaneously and the data is written into a single test report.
| Parameter | Sensor | Range | Accuracy |
|---|---|---|---|
| Thrust | load cell + HX711 ADC | −15,000 … 25,000 g | ± 3 % |
| Torque | load cell + HX711 ADC | −4.5 … 4.5 N·m | ± 2 % |
| Motor rpm | optical sensor | 0 … 60,000 rpm | ± 100 rpm |
| Current (channel 1) | measuring shunt | 0 … 150 A | ± 1 % |
| Current (channel 2) | Hall sensor | 0 … 150 A | ± 2 % |
| Voltage at the ESC | ADC via divider | 0 … 60 V | ± 0,5 % |
| Winding temperature | non-contact IR MLX90614 | 0 … 230 °C | ± 5 °C |
From the measured data the software calculates power draw, specific thrust (g/W) and the motor’s KV rating.
Uragan technical specifications
| Supply voltage of the motor under test | 20 … 59 V |
| Maximum current of the motor under test | 110 A |
| Speed control | PWM 1100 … 1940 µs |
| Bench power supply | 220 V, no more than 0.1 A |
| Dimensions (L×W×H) | 500 × 500 × 600 mm |
| Weight | 11 kg |
| Computer link | Bluetooth |
The current and voltage limits are set by the supplied ESC and can be changed to suit your task.
MTStand software
The bench ships with software of our own design: it controls the test modes, records telemetry, produces reports and keeps the test history.
The software is registered in the Rospatent Register of Computer Programs, certificate No. 2026664791, rights holder Motorno LLC. This is not a third-party product with uncertain support but our own software, which we develop and maintain.
- live sensor readings and charts;
- a test database linked to motor, propeller and batch;
- export of results to xlsx, csv and PDF;
- ready-made test reports to accompany a delivery.
Delivery set and operating conditions
In the box
- the Uragan test bench, assembled;
- a Hobbywing FlyFun HV V5 110A ESC;
- MTStand software;
- a quick-start guide;
- the bench passport with individual calibration coefficients.
Operating conditions
- temperature from 10 to 40 °C;
- relative humidity up to 95 % without condensation;
- no vibration and no electrically conductive dust;
- the manufacturer warrants the bench when these conditions are met.
Every bench goes through factory calibration — the conversion coefficients are measured for that specific unit and recorded in its passport.
